The police say that the suspects belong to a gang that provides maid services to the households in Lahore

Lahore: At least two maids were arrested on Wednesday over charges of filming in appropriate videos of the families and blackmailing them in the provincial capital.
The Race Course Police station registered FIR against two maids on complaint of a woman, the resident of Islamia Park.
According to the complainant, the women belong to a gang working in the households and secretly filming the families to blackmail them.
The suspects took employment under the guise of domestic help and then covertly recorded inappropriate videos of young girls in the households. The videos were later being used to harass and blackmail the families.

The suspects arrested over the said charges were identified as Arooj Fatima and Jameela Bibi. The police said they also recovered dozens of inappropriate videos from them.
The police also conducted raids to arrest the owner of the agency involved in providing maid services to the households.
The owner of the agency, who is suspected to be the mastermind behind the scheme, is currently on the run. The further investigation is underway.
